Jack 'Action' Zwerner is an American businessman and poker player. He is known for winning the 2006 World Series of Poker (WSOP) Event 8: Omaha Hi-Lo (8 or better). [1] T. J. Cloutier called him "the best heads-up Omaha player ever". [2] Zwerner was an executive at the Dunes Hotel, Caesar's Palace the Golden Nugget, and the Las Vegas Hilton. [1]
The casino usually takes a rake (commission) or a time charge. Whether a poker player can win enough from the game to cover the rake and make a profit depends, aside from the rake level, not only on the player's skill, but also on the opposition's lack thereof - the degree of difficulty can vary widely from casino to casino.
Bobby Baldwin (born c. 1950) [1] is a professional poker player and casino executive. As a poker player, Baldwin is best known as the winner of the 1978 World Series of Poker Main Event, becoming the youngest Main Event champion at that time.

Doyle Frank Brunson (August 10, 1933 – May 14, 2023) was an American poker player who played professionally for over 60 years. [4] He was a two-time World Series of Poker (WSOP) Main Event champion, a Poker Hall of Fame inductee, and the author of several books on poker. Brunson was the first player to win $1 million in poker tournaments. [5]
